The Revolution Has Begun

The Revolution Has Begun

Year: 2013

Runtime: 152 mins

Language: Hindi

Director: Prakash Jha

Drama

This film follows interconnected characters—a son seeking his father, a grieving father, a woman hardened by life, and an impulsive activist—as their paths converge. They unite to challenge a ruthless and ambitious despot determined to crush their rebellion and dismantle the established order, shaking the foundations of power.

The Revolution Has Begun (2013) – Full Plot Summary & Ending Explained

Retired teacher Dwarka Anand is an idealistic man. His engineer son Akhilesh’s friend Manav is an ambitious capitalist. Manav meets Dwarka before Akhilesh’s wedding, and declares his intentions to go abroad to study and then return to start his own company. Dwarka does not care for his capitalist ideas and calls them greed. Manav is also against the socialist mindset of Dwarka and both enter an uneasy silence. Dwarka then kicks Manav out of the house after he hears Manav try to persuade Akhilesh to give up his Govt job, put his marriage on hold and to come with him to US and to secure both their futures.

Three years later, Manav is a successful telecom entrepreneur and sits with highly influential people in business and politics. He manipulates people at a national level to get things done for himself. Yasmin is a journalist who does Tehelka-type stings to expose the dirty secrets of the same influential folks. Manav cherishes his friend Akhilesh, who suddenly dies in a highway accident. At that time, Akhilesh is also investigating the cause of a bridge collapse that was sanctioned by the Highway minister Balram Singh. Akhilesh is the chief engineer and in charge of construction.

Manav reaches Akhilesh’s town to console Sumitra. Sumitra, Akhilesh’s wife, cannot get the compensation despite daily applications in government offices. She hopes to use the money to build a local school, Akhilesh’s dream. Incensed, Dwarka slaps an arrogant official and gets imprisoned.

Arjun Singh is a dropout from Dwarka’s school and now a local goon who fights the government for local causes. He tries to help Dwarka, but he refuses any help from him on principle. Manav returns to the town and starts a campaign to free him, using social media, roping in Arjun Singh and Yasmin. Arjun uses his local muscle to mobilize one lakh people on the streets and Yasmin covers the story to make it national news in a fight against corruption.

The chief minister urges Balram to act (he is the local MLA as well), and Balram frees Dwarka the same day. Balram also offers him the check to clear Akhilesh’s compensation dues, but Dwarka refuses the payment and gives Balram 30 days to clear the dues of each and every petitioner in the district. Dwarka is obliged by Manav’s efforts to free him and he announces that he feels he has found his son back.

While this is going on, Yasmin uses Akhilesh’s computer at home and finds his resignation letter mentioning some confidential report. She mentions it to Manav but they decide not to pursue.

Now Arjun, Manav and Yasmin join hands to gather the records of all the claims submitted in the district. Manav devises the strategy and Arjun puts together the manpower to execute the same. The campaign is massively successful and Balram panics. He orders lathi-charge on peaceful gatherings organized by the Dwarka camp. He also arrests Manav and tells him that he has exposed his corrupt business dealings and next time Manav will be shipped out dead.

This expose kills the Dwarka campaign as public loses all trust in Manav and hence Dwarka. In response Manav sells his company and returns the money to his shareholders and returns to Dwarka and apologizes for using incorrect means to grow his business. The campaign goes back on track and gathers steam. The chief minister and Balram invite Manav and Dwarka for talks. During talks Balram takes Manav aside and tells him that the bridge that collapsed had a design fault and Akhilesh was responsible for it. Manav investigates by accessing Akhilesh’s work computer and finds that days before his accident, Akhilesh had written a report to the Chief Minister implicating Balram’s brother Sangram Singh for the collapse of the bridge as the contracting agency by using cheap and substandard material. He further investigates and finds that Sangram Singh was directly involved in the truck accident that killed Akhilesh. It wasn’t an accident, Akhilesh was killed.

Manav approaches the Home Minister who advises Manav to drop the Chief Minister from his complaint to allow him to take action against Sangram. Sangram is arrested. But the Govt still refuses to take action on clearing the claims and dues, so Dwarka decides to go on hunger strike. The hunger strike forces the Chief Minister to invite Manav for talks, but Balram is no mood to compromise. He refuses to support any anti-corruption ordinance and his eight MLAs who support the Govt are crucial to its survival. As Dwarka continues his hunger strike, he gets sick. In response some of his supporters kill some policemen. In response, Balram sends in the CRPF forces. Now Arjun cordons off the entire town from within and refuses entry to central forces, as the town descends into chaos, Balram orders the killing of Dwarka. Manav is also shot while trying to save him. Dwarka dies, Balram is arrested and Manav and Arjun join hands to launch a political party to change the system from within.
